深度学习中的Tokenim训练方法解析

引言

在深度学习领域,模型的训练方法是影响模型性能的关键因素之一。尤其是在自然语言处理(NLP)和计算机视觉(CV)中,Tokenim方法作为一种新兴的训练策略,正在受到越来越多的关注。本文将深入探讨Tokenim训练方法的原理及应用,也会提供实用的训练技巧以及面临的挑战。通过具体的案例分析与理论探讨,希望能够为有兴趣的读者提供全面的理解与实际指导。

Tokenim训练方法的基本概念

Tokenim是一种基于"token"的训练策略。Token在NLP中通常指代单词或词组,而在CV中则可以是像素或特征点。在Tokenim训练中,模型以token为基本单位进行训练,而不是传统的整句话或整幅图像。这种做法有效降低了训练复杂性,提高了训练效率。

具体而言,Tokenim训练方法通过以下几个步骤实施:

  1. 数据准备:收集或生成带有token标签的数据集。
  2. 模型构建:选择适当的模型架构,如Transformer等,调整输入层以接受token数据。
  3. 训练:使用预定义的损失函数和器,进行模型训练。

通过这种方式,模型能够更精准地学习到token之间的关联关系,从而提升性能。

Tokenim训练方法的优势

Tokenim训练方法相较于传统训练方法有许多优势:

  1. 高效性:由于token为基本单元,训练过程中的计算量显著降低,能够更快收敛。
  2. 可扩展性:Tokenim方法容易搭配各种数据类型,适应性强。
  3. 灵活性:可结合多种模型架构,便于实验与实现创新。

Tokenim训练方法的应用场景

Tokenim训练方法广泛应用于多个领域,特别是自然语言处理和计算机视觉。在NLP中,Tokenim能够有效识别文本中的关键字、短语及其上下文关系。而在CV中,该方法可以帮助模型更好地理解图像内容,从而进行更精准的识别和分类。

例如,在图像识别任务中,使用Tokenim训练方法的模型可以将图像分解为多个区域(tokens),并学习区域之间的关系,形成整体的图像理解能力。这种区域级别的训练不仅提高了性能,也可以实现更高效的推理过程。

Tokenim训练方法的挑战

尽管Tokenim训练方法具有诸多优势,但在实际应用中也面临挑战:

  1. 数据依赖性:Tokenim方法高度依赖高质量的训练数据,如果数据本身存在偏差,模型的性能也难以提升。
  2. 模型复杂性:为了充分利用Tokenim训练方法,模型架构可能变得复杂,增加了实现和调优难度。
  3. 可解释性:基于token的模型可能在可解释性上有所欠缺,难以理清决策背后的逻辑。

常见问题解析

Tokenim训练方法与传统训练方法的区别是什么?

Tokenim训练方法与传统训练方法最大的区别在于基础单位的选择。在传统的训练方法中,模型通常以句子、段落或整幅图像为单元进行训练,而Tokenim则将分析单元细化为更小的token。这意味着,Tokenim可以在更细粒度的层面上捕捉数据特征,从而实现更高的表达能力。同时,由于处理的单元较小,训练过程中的计算复杂性也显著下降,这使得模型能够在相对较短的时间内达到较好的性能。

从应用效果来看,Tokenim方法对于动态变化大的数据集表现更为优越。比如在处理富含上下文信息的文本数据时,Tokenim可以迅速识别并学习token之间的关系,而传统方法往往难以快速适应数据的变化。此外,Tokenim方法更适合用于大规模数据的训练,因为它独特的结构化方式可以更好地发挥并行计算的优势,进一步提升训练效率。

如何评估Tokenim训练方法的效果?

评估Tokenim训练方法效果的标准与传统模型的评估是相似的,然而也有一些特定的考量。首先,评估指标一般包括准确率、召回率、F1值等。但是,更加重要的是需要考虑到token的解析和学习的有效性。为了评估Tokenim模型的效果,通常需要通过以下步骤:

  1. 选择合适的数据集:确保数据集的多样性和代表性,以便充分测试模型的普适性。
  2. 设定基线:使用传统训练方法作为对照组,确保可比性。
  3. 使用多样化的评估指标:除了标准性能指标外,还应考虑token的捕捉能力和上下文理解能力,必要时可采用定性分析增加评估的全面性。

此外,结合可解释性分析的结果,可以进一步深入理解Tokenim模型的表现。在具体评估中,也可以通过混淆矩阵分析、误差分析等方法,总结模型的优缺点,帮助指导后续的改进。

Tokenim训练方法如何在实践中实现?

在实践中实现Tokenim训练方法,可以遵循以下步骤:

  1. 数据预处理:首先,需要对数据进行预处理,将输入文本或图像数据转化为tokens。这可能包括分词、标注等步骤,确保每个token都有适当的语义值。
  2. 模型设计:选择适合的模型架构,如Transformer。需要保证模型的输入层能够接受token信息,并在前向传播时有效利用这些token之间的关系。
  3. 训练参数设置:选择合适的器和损失函数,设定学习率等超参数,控制训练过程的稳定性和效果。
  4. 评估与调优:在训练后进行效果评估,识别问题并进行调优。这可能包括调整模型架构、复查数据质量等。

在实际框架上,可以使用TensorFlow、PyTorch等深度学习框架实现Tokenim训练方法。在这些平台上,使用现成的库和工具可以大大简化训练过程,并能够充分利用GPU加速等硬件特性。

Tokenim训练方法对数据质量的要求如何?

Tokenim训练方法对数据质量的要求相对较高。这是因为数据的质量直接影响到模型训练的效果和最终的推理能力。首先,数据应具有完整性和多样性,以便模型能够全面学习各类token及其组合的特征。其次,数据内部不应存在显著偏差或噪声,这些因素可能导致模型学习到错误的模式,并在实际应用中表现不佳。

为确保数据质量,建议进行如下操作:

  1. 清洗数据:去除重复、无效或噪音数据,以保证数据的纯粹性。
  2. 标签准确性:确保对tokens的标注是准确和一致的。这可能需要专家审查,尤其是在复杂任务中。
  3. 数据增强:通过生成对抗网络或其他增强技术,扩展数据集的多样性,提高模型的泛化能力。

数据质量的提高,能够显著提升Tokenim模型的表现,在多样化场景中取得更好的效果。

未来Tokenim训练方法的发展前景如何?

Tokenim训练方法作为一种新兴的训练策略,其发展前景值得关注。随着深度学习技术的不断发展,Tokenim方法有望结合更多的新理论和新技术,提高其在多领域的应用能力。

  • 与大规模预训练模型结合:未来可能会开发出基于Tokenim的预训练模型,使得在特定任务上进行微调变得更加简便。
  • 应用于跨领域任务:Tokenim方法的灵活性使其适合于多种数据类型的结合,如文本与图像的组合,能够解决跨领域的问题。
  • 提高可解释性:通过结合可解释人工智能技术,为Tokenim训练方法的结果提供更深层次的理解,增强模型的可解释性,让用户更容易理解模型决策。

总之,随着技术的不断创新与应用场景的扩展,Tokenim训练方法将展现出更加广阔的未来,成为深度学习不可或缺的重要一环。

总结

Tokenim训练方法凭借其独特的结构化训练方式与高效性能,正逐渐成为深度学习领域的重要研究方向。尽管面临一定的挑战,但通过数据质量、模型设计等方面,有望进一步提升其性能和应用范围。对于研究人员和实践者而言,深入理解Tokenim训练方法,将为他们在未来的项目中带来创新和突破。